Mastering the Art of Scholarship Letters: A Comprehensive Guide
Writing a compelling scholarship letter is a critical step in securing financial aid for academic pursuits. A well-crafted letter not only showcases your academic achievements but also demonstrates your commitment to your field of study. In this guide, we will explore the principles of academic mastery through 16 sample scholarship letters, each highlighting different aspects of academic excellence and personal dedication.
These examples are designed to provide inspiration and guidance for students seeking to articulate their academic goals and achievements effectively. Each letter adheres to the principles of clarity, professionalism, and persuasive writing, ensuring that your application stands out.
By studying these samples, you will gain insights into how to present your academic mastery in a way that aligns with the goals of scholarship committees. Whether you are applying for undergraduate or graduate studies, these letters will serve as valuable templates for your own scholarship applications.

Conclusion: Mastering the Scholarship Letter
Crafting a compelling scholarship letter is a skill that requires careful thought and attention to detail. By studying these 16 examples, you can gain valuable insights into how to present your academic achievements and personal goals effectively. Remember to tailor each letter to the specific scholarship and highlight your unique strengths and experiences.
Whether you are applying for academic excellence, community service, or leadership scholarships, the key is to demonstrate your commitment to your field and your potential to make a meaningful impact. Use these samples as a starting point and personalize your letters to stand out to scholarship committees.
